High Temperature Conveyor Rollers: An Overview of Functionality

High temperature conveyor rollers play a crucial role in various industries, especially where heat is a critical factor. These rollers are designed to transport materials at elevated temperatures, often exceeding 200°C. Their robust construction helps maintain performance, even in harsh conditions.

Several industry reports highlight the importance of high temperature conveyor systems. According to a recent study, the demand for these rollers is expected to grow by 5% annually. This growth is attributed to increasing use in sectors like metal processing and recycling. However, achieving optimal performance requires careful selection. Material compatibility and environmental factors should not be overlooked.

Tips: Regular maintenance checks can prevent breakdowns. Inspect rollers for wear and tear frequently. It’s important to address minor issues before they escalate. Additionally, consider the right temperature ratings for the materials being transported. Choosing an unsuitable roller can lead to inefficiencies or damage.

These rollers face challenges too. Over time, exposure to high temperatures can degrade materials. Operators must be vigilant about performance issues that arise. Often, the focus on production can overshadow the need for proper maintenance. It’s essential to find a balance that favors both efficiency and reliability.

Applications of High Temperature Conveyor Rollers in Various Industries

High temperature conveyor rollers are becoming essential across various industries. These rollers are designed to withstand extreme conditions. The food processing and metalworking sectors rely heavily on these components. In the food industry, they facilitate the transport of items in ovens and fryers. According to recent data, high-temperature conveyor systems can endure temperatures exceeding 400°F.

In metalworking, these rollers manage hot metals directly off production lines. Their resilience minimizes downtime and enhances productivity. The automotive sector is also benefiting from their use during component forging processes. Many manufacturing experts highlight that incorporating high-temperature rollers can improve operational efficiency by 30%.

Tips: Regular checks on roller conditions are crucial. High heat can warp or damage materials over time. Keep a spare set of rollers for quick replacements. Also, ensure proper lubrication to enhance their lifespan. Reflect on how often these components are inspected in your operations. Identifying potential issues early can save costs later.

Key Benefits of Using High Temperature Conveyor Rollers in Manufacturing

High temperature conveyor rollers offer significant advantages in manufacturing. They excel in environments that face extreme heat. These rollers ensure smooth material handling, even at elevated temperatures. This efficiency can boost overall productivity in production lines.

One key benefit is durability. High temperature rollers resist deformation, which prolongs their lifespan. This resistance means less frequent replacements, saving both time and money. For high-temperature applications, these rollers maintain performance, reducing overall operational costs.

Tips for choosing the right rollers: Look for materials that can withstand specific heat levels. Check load capacity to ensure they meet production demands. Regular maintenance is essential. Inspect for wear, and ensure they are free from debris.

These rollers can also improve safety. They minimize risks related to overheating. However, improper installation can lead to problems. Evaluate your setup regularly to avoid issues. Don't underestimate the importance of quality materials.
